Catastrophe in the Alps Synopsis
"A mountaineering expedition in search of the victims of an Alpine tragedy, in which two well known climbers lost their lives. A beautifully pathetic subject. Shorn of the repugnant features associated with such an event, the sadness evoked by what remains is more than compensated by the unusualness of the scenes depicted. Weird, but sublime in their photographic perfection, the Alpine views are magnificent. Wonderful ice fields, glaciers, crags, crevasses, snow-clad pinnacles, and chasms, in all their thrilling majesty, sublime silence and snowy desolation, pass each other in rapid succession, each scene more beautiful than the last. Surprising and entrancing as are the views, additional interest is lent by the portrayal of the search for the two victims of Alpine climbing. The event has been handled with judgment, and the result is a series of pictures crammed with exciting and thrilling incidents..."
Catastrophe in the Alps (1906) is a documentary film, released on October 8, 1906.
